MFC-Dialogfenster ausblenden

Ich habe eine auf MFC-Dialogen basierende Anwendung geschrieben, die von einer anderen Anwendung gestartet wird. Im Moment habe ich keinen Code hinzugefügt. Es sind nur die Standarddateien, die ich erhalten habe. Die andere Anwendung kann meine Anwendung erfolgreich starten.

Ich versuche, das Fenster meiner Anwendung auszublenden, wenn die andere Anwendung sie startet.

BOOL CMyApp::InitInstance()
{
    CMyAppDlg dlg;
    m_pMainWnd = &dlg;        

    INT_PTR nResponse = dlg.DoModal();

    if (nResponse == IDOK)
    {
    }
    else if (nResponse == IDCANCEL)
    { 
    }

    return FALSE;
}

Ich habe versucht zu benutzen:

dlg.ShowWindow(SW_HIDE) 

aber es verbirgt immer noch nicht das Fenster.

Wie kann ich diese Aufgabe erfüllen?

Antworten auf die Frage(6)

Ihre Antwort auf die Frage